1792 Reni (1968 BG) is a main-belt asteroid discovered on January 24, 1968 by L. Chernykh at Nauchnyj.

Photometric observations of this asteroid collected during 2008 show a rotation period of 15.95 ± 0.02 hours with a brightness variation of 0.54 ± 0.06 magnitude.[1]
